Albright Athletics Hall of Fame
Fotopoulos was a member of the Albright Men's Tennis team. During his time with the Lions he was named to the All-MAC first team three consecutive years (1999-2001). During his freshman year, Fotopoulos was a key member of the undefeated 1998 MAC Championship team. The Lions' were the first undefeated MAC champion since 1972, and the feat has not been achieved again since. During his junior and senior team, in addition to being named a team captain, he was also the recipient of the William Ruoff Award (Team MVP). Fotopoulos set the school record for singles wins in a season (20), singles wins in a career (63), doubles wins in a season (14), doubles wins in a career (44), and total career wins (107). All of those records still stand today. Fotopoulos graduated in 2001 with a degree in marketing and French.
